Instant Orthodontics can transform a crooked, uneven smile to one that's straight, even and white in only 2 to 3 visits, without the use of metal braces.
How? With the artistic application of porcelain veneers.
Veneers are thin shells of fired porcelain that are placed on the front surfaces of the teeth. Offering a natural look and feel, veneers allow the cosmetic dentist to dramatically change the length, width, color and shape of a tooth. Restoring teeth to their natural beauty, veneers also resist staining, creating an enduring white, bright straight smile.

Once it's determined which teeth need to be veneered, the dentist takes an impression of the patient's teeth. That impression is sent to a lab with precise instructions of what's to be done. The lab creates a "wax up" - a wax model of how the enhanced smile will look. The patient and dentist review the wax up and either make changes or give the lab approval to proceed. From the wax up, the lab creates the patient's new "teeth" of porcelain.
Once the wax up is approved, the dentist prepares the patient's teeth and fits him or her with temporaries (temporary version of the "new smile".) When the porcelain veneers are ready, the temporaries are removed and the veneers are bonded to the teeth.

Patients can expect recovery to be about the same as with any dental procedure. The gums may be tender and a bit swollen for a couple days after the veneers are bonded to the teeth. Over the counter anti-inflammatory medications, such as ibuprofen, can ease any minor discomfort.
After a few days, the veneers may need to be adjusted to provide a more comfortable bite or fit.
Luckily, complications from dental procedures are uncommon. A bacterial infection following the procedure may occur and can be easily treated with antibiotics.

Instant Orthodontics can involve just the upper teeth, or the upper and lower teeth combined. Depending on how many teeth are treated, procedure costs may range from $10,000 to $12,000 for 10 anterior veneers to $30,000 - $40,000 for uppers and lowers. Most dentists offer third party financing to make monthly payments reasonable.
